How much do full time data entry j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time data entry in Madison, WI is $19.62,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.49 and $22.02 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full time data entry professional?

To thrive as a Full Time Data Entry professional, you need strong attention to detail, fast and accurate typing skills,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with spreadsheet software like Microsoft Excel, database management systems, and sometimes data entry certifications are commonly required. Reliability, organization, and the ability to manage repetitive tasks with focus are standout soft skills in this field. These abilities are essential for maintaining data integrity, meeting productivity targets, and supporting smooth business operations.

What is a full time data entry?

A full time data entry job involves entering, updating, and maintaining information in computer systems and databases for an organization. Employees in this role typically work 35-40 hours per week and are responsible for ensuring data accuracy, organizing files, and sometimes verifying or correcting data. These jobs usually require strong attention to detail, good typing skills, and basic computer proficiency. Full time data entry positions can be found in many industries, including healthcare, finance, retail, and government.

What are some common challenges faced in a full time data entry role, and how can they be managed?

Full-time data entry professionals often encounter challenges such as repetitive tasks, maintaining accuracy over long periods, and meeting tight deadlines. To manage these challenges, it's important to take regular short breaks to prevent fatigue, use keyboard shortcuts to increase efficiency, and double-check work for errors. Many organizations provide structured workflows and supportive teams to help employees stay organized and maintain productivity. Collaborating with supervisors and colleagues can also offer guidance and help resolve any issues quickly.

Now Hiring Material Handler II at our Janesville, Wisconsin Distribution Center
This is a full - time position of 40 hours. Working Monday through Friday (8:00 AM - 4:30 PM) No Weekends or Holidays!! Paid Time Off includes 18 days available during your first year. Imperial offers Day 1 benefits including medical, dental, vision. Six paid holidays and the company contributes 6% to a 401K with immediate vesting.
In this full time Material Handler II role, you will safely and accurately be picking orders and cycle counting using powered industrial equipment. The position will be responsible for checking and boxing of picked product.
Learn more about this position! https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=rCEf_ecgRnU
Specifically, you will be packaging inbound material including using package labeling system and printers, automated packaging equipment, scales, tape guns, mechanical stapler, and shrink wrapping. Documenting packaging activity using radio frequency scanners and keyboard data entry. Maintaining stock of packaging supplies at packaging stations. Picking orders using safe operation of powered industrial equipment, label printers, radio frequency scanners and keyboard data entry and performing cart put away using powered industrial equipment. Other tasks include restocking and picking using powered industrial equipment, assisting with inventory counting. You must be able to lift and carry up to 50 lbs. and have the ability to spend most of the time standing and walking in a warehouse environment.
Your background should include: a High School diploma/GED equivalent and one (1) year of general knowledge of distribution/manufacturing operations.
